AMAZING. PURE EXCELLENCE.
I was referred to Elite MD after a horrible experience with a BBL from another surgeon. I not only hated my results, but the process was horrible and I ended up in ER shortly after. I wasn’t looking to spend the money to have my botched results fixed, but I was referred to Dr. Bansal and decided to just go for it.
It was life changing! I have experience with three other surgeons and have consulted with many more. This wasn’t my first rodeo, so I have the experience to confidently state: Dr. Bansal is hands down the best. I am writing this review hoping that other women don’t make the mistake I did – money wasted, painful recovery from botched procedures. I know that so many women are tempted to either a) go to a cheap and unsafe “Build a Barbie” clinic in Miami or Mexico or b) overpay for a surgeon in Beverly Hills and think that the high cost means great service and results. Because it still is somewhat taboo for your average 40-50 year old working professional, lawyer, doctor, etc to have plastic surgery, we don’t talk about it and share our experiences. I am sharing mine because I want women like myself to be well-informed.
I could write a novel on my experience (and I am happy to provide more details for any prospective clients, just message me), but here are the main points.
Why I love Dr. Bansal and Elite MD:
1. Before the procedure: extensive and thorough consultation to truly understand what you as the patient want, need, and are concerned about. I felt like the team was invested in knowing as much as possible about me and my medical history, and committed to educating me about the procedure and how to ensure success. The consultations, reading materials, guides, and recommended YouTube videos, podcasts, and Netflix documentaries gave me so much reassurance. Before Elite, I had to seek out all of my own information (thank you RealSelf!). Elite MD provides you with everything.
2. After the procedure: I only knew about lymphatic drainage massage from my own attempts at research online before my first BBL. Elite MD includes them in your package! They have an amazing, certified massage therapist – Rema -- that has magic hands. You don’t have to guess at how to maintain your results and ensure the best recovery – they tell you everything you need and have the staff to do it. One stop shop!
3. Total transformation of mind and body: this wasn’t just about one procedure. It’s a holistic body transformation. We discussed physical health, mental and emotional health, spiritual well-being, and longevity. No other surgeon has ever discussed any of this with me – which is why four years ago after my first procedure I cried for a week and had no idea the emotional implications of this process. I still regularly speak with Dr. Bansal about maintaining my results, and living a healthy and joyful lifestyle.
4. Dr. Bansal was the first and only surgeon to acknowledge that as a Black woman, my skin, muscles and bones have their own biological characteristics. I loved the special care given to women of color, and the expertise and experience from a diverse staff. Black women aren’t the typical targeted group of clients outside of Atlanta or Miami. And yet every Black woman I know has considered elective procedures (and has plenty of disposable income for it).
5. The entire staff, especially Vanessa the Director of Care, exhibits pure excellence: no question was too big or too small. Her knowledge, warmth, and dedication was exceptional. She guided me through the whole process, checked in regularly before and after. In my previous surgeries, I was completely on my own. I wasn’t even seen for 2 weeks after my first BBL procedure elsewhere. With Dr. B, I was back the day after, then the day after that, and then regularly for the first few weeks. Vanessa called and texted to ensure all was well. This was HUGE. This is NOT typical for other surgeons. When I started ugly crying during my second post-op procedure, everyone was so loving. Cheryl, my angel, the Chief of Staff, came over and held me. I just cannot explain how well cared for I was. A BBL is very invasive and recovery is tough no matter what. You need a team to help you and I had that.
6. RESULTS, RESULTS, RESULTS!! I had major hip dips before my first BBL. Most of the fat transfer didn’t survive. My “after” picture looked no different than my first. After Dr. Bansal fixed my BBL, I have the body of my dreams. He is a perfectionist, takes his time, and really is an artist that will sculpt and snatch your body. I am blown away and couldn’t be happier. As a patient that lived with a botched BBL for two years prior, I didn’t think I would ever be happy. I am so glad I was blessed with a referral to Elite MD and I am paying it forward and hoping to bless someone else!
